43051-46-3
3-Benzamidophenyliminodiethanol
(3-(N,N-二羟乙基)氨基苯甲酰苯胺)
Product Code:
231663
Molecular Formula:
C17H20N2O3
Molecular Weight:
300.35
Order 43051-46-3
benzamidophenyliminodiethanol,CASNo 43051-46-3